Attorney Açar: Increase in abuse cases directly linked to judicial decisions 2020-07-20 12:43:01 ŞIRNAK - Stating that the increase in abuse cases can not be handled independently from the judicial decisions and the policies of the current government, Şırnak Bar Association Women and Children Rights Commission Att. Zozan Açar drew attention to 'impunity' policies. While the discussion on the abuse of a child by a specialized sergeant in Şırnak continues, it turned out that similar cases was experienced in other cities. Şırnak Bar Association Women and Children Rights Commission Att. Zozan Açar evaluated the protests pf the people against child molestation. Açar pointed out that the increase in these abuse cases is directly linked to judicial decisions.   Açar said: "The perpetrator or perpetrators calculate that the judicial mechanism will not respect the statements of the victim child due to their position and power. The victims can remain silent most of the time because they know that the perpetrator will be protected."  Noting that there were not enough reactions to the three abuse cases in the city recently, Açar underlined the importance of the impunity policies of the government.  Stating that the perpetrators' not being punished creates a perception in the society that they will also not be punished if they had done the same, Açar said that the perpetrators thinks that they will be released in a short time from prison even if they were sentenced to prison.   VIOLENCE AND ABUSE ARE POLITICAL   Stating that the violence against women and children is politic, Açar emphasized that the cases of violence and abuse can not be handled independently from the current policies of the government. The perpetrator's protection situation, which occurs in each incident, provides the ground for the occurrence of new cases. This cycle continues as the perpetrator knows that he will not be punished and isolated from society in this political and judicial system. When the perpetrator becomes a public official, the judicial bodies and the press protects the perpetrator. As a matter of fact, although the investigation continued in the speacialized seargent case, all segments of the society favoured the perpetrator because he was a public official who claimed that he was slandered."   EFFORT NEEDED TO CHANGE THE SYSTEM   Stating that an effort should be made in order to change the system, Açar emphasized that the discussions on withdrawing from İstanbul Agreement should be abandoned immediately.   Stating that they will be the followers of the recent abuse cases as a commission, Açar said that the bar associations will support the families and children who are abused with the support of associations and NGOs that protect women's and children's rights. Açar emphasized that they will be the followers of the incidents so that no sexual abuse incidents remain in the dark.   MA / Zeynep Durgut
